    Sacramento Monarchs at Chicago Sky (-7.5, 144)

    Even their worst offensive performance of the season couldn't keep the Chicago Sky from extending the best home start in franchise history. The WNBA's worst team may not be able to stop them, either.

    The Sky look to improve to 5-0 at the UIC Pavilion on Tuesday when they take on the Sacramento Monarchs, owners of the league's worst record.

    Chicago (5-3), which hasn't finished with a winning record in its first three seasons of existence, is in second place in the Eastern Conference, one game behind Indiana. Almost all of that success can be attributed to the Sky's play at home, where they improved to a franchise-record 4-0 on Saturday, beating Washington 68-63.

    The Sky won despite shooting a season-low 37.5 percent for the game, and scoring only eight points in the opening quarter. Candice Dupree led the way with 23 points, while Jia Perkins added 14 points and eight steals, and Sylvia Fowles had 13 points and 10 rebounds.

    "It's nice to have more than one player who likes to put the team on her back,'' Dupree said. "Syl had some huge rebounds and I was trying to crash the offensive boards. It was a total team effort.''

    Chicago's effort has been vastly improved at home, where it went 17-34 over its previous three seasons. The Sky are averaging fewer points at home (72.8) than on the road (79.3), but they are giving up an average of 26 fewer points at the UIC Pavilion.

    "This year we're more consistent (at home)," Fowles said. "Anytime last year it might have been 'Yeah, whatever,' but we're very focused this year and want to win."

    Fowles and the Sky could have an easy time against Sacramento (1-7), which is winless in five road games including the first three of its current five-game trip.

    The Monarchs average 72.4 points per game - fifth-fewest in the WNBA - and they've been held to 69.0 points on the road. Sacramento has also lost five in a row overall, including an 86-72 defeat at Detroit on Sunday. It closes this trip Thursday at Minnesota.

    Washington Mystics at San Antonio Silver Stars (-3, 146)

    Becky Hammon's return has given the San Antonio Silver Stars an immediate lift. Now she'll try to help the defending Western Conference champions move above .500 for the first time this season Tuesday night when they host the Washington Mystics.

    Hammon missed two games for San Antonio (3-3) earlier this month while playing with the Russian national team in the European women's championships. Without her, the Silver Stars suffered double-digit losses at New York and Connecticut.

    San Antonio has won both games since its leading scorer returned, beating Phoenix 91-87 last Tuesday and defeating Sacramento 62-52 on Friday. After scoring 19 points against the Mercury, Hammon had a season-high 26 on Friday to go with her five rebounds, six assists and five steals.

    "I thought Becky really thought the game out well, as she put us in some situations that were really good," Silver Stars coach Dan Hughes said.

    Hughes' team jumped out to a 20-7 lead at the end of the first quarter, but had to hold off a rally by Sacramento in the fourth. The Silver Stars shot only 39.7 percent, but outscored the Monarchs 13-3 at the free-throw line. Hammon was 10 of 10 at the line.

    Despite scoring fewer than 65 points for the fourth time this season, San Antonio is hoping Hammon's return will improve an offense which is among the league's worst at 69.0 points per game.

    Hammon averaged 24.0 points as the Silver Stars won both meetings last season with Washington (4-3).

    The Mystics were held below 75 points for the first time this year in their last game, falling 68-63 at Chicago on Saturday for their second straight loss following a 4-1 start.
